Brad Garlinghouse, the CEO of Ripple, spoke about the importance of XRP as a financial bridge that enhances efficiency in cross-border transfers through the RippleNet network, noting that it plays a vital role in reducing costs and speeding up transactions compared to traditional financial systems. He also hinted in posts on platform X that the U.S. may accumulate reserves of XRP, raising speculation about a potential price increase.

As for price forecasts, there are no specific reports in the available information indicating an expectation for XRP to reach $15 directly. However, there are optimistic projections from analysts, such as a report from LiteFinance suggesting a potential price range for 2030 between $9.43 and $72.72, based on improved regulatory conditions and increased adoption of Ripple's technology. Other analysts, like Javan Marks, mentioned ambitious forecasts reaching $288 based on logarithmic analysis, but these predictions remain speculative and uncertain.

The market has experienced volatility, with XRP recently reaching around $2.54 supported by 'dollar distancing' trends and the expansion of the Ripple network. However, some analyses indicate the possibility of a short-term correction towards $1.94 due to technical patterns like the 'double top.'

It should be noted that price forecasts carry high risks and do not necessarily reflect guaranteed outcomes, and investors are advised to exercise caution and conduct their own research.

Analysis of XRP forecasts for the coming week (June 7-13, 2025):

1 Current Market Situation:

◦ As of June 6, 2025, XRP is trading at around $2.42, down slightly by 1.67% over 24 hours, but with a weekly increase of 2.70% and a monthly increase of 14.67%, indicating resilience in short-term volatility.

◦ The 14-day Relative Strength Index (RSI) is at 55.13, which is in the neutral zone, indicating that XRP is not in overbought or oversold territory.

◦ The simple moving averages (SMA) for 50 days and 200 days are at $2.20 and $1.91 respectively, forming short-term support.

2 Short-Term Forecasts:

◦ Bullish Scenario: If XRP breaks through the resistance level at $3.40 (all-time high), it could rise to $4.50 by June 2025, supported by technical signals like the 'hidden ascending channel' and 'inverse head and shoulders' pattern, along with market confidence resulting from the progress of Ripple's case with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). However, this target may be distant from next week, but levels like $2.85-$3.00 could be potential short-term targets.

◦ Conservative Scenario: If macroeconomic risks worsen or regulatory uncertainties persist, XRP may retreat to a support level at $1.80, or even $2.05 according to CoinCodex forecasts. Elliott Wave analysis suggests a potential bearish correction with a sell target at $1.868.

3 Influencing Factors:

◦ Regulation: The Ripple case with the SEC remains the biggest factor. If positive news emerges regarding a final settlement in 2025, it could lead to an influx of institutional money and price increases.

◦ Market Sentiment: Current sentiment is 'greedy', reflecting optimism, but volatility in the cryptocurrency market, especially Bitcoin and Ethereum, may impact XRP.

◦ Institutional Adoption: Continued growth in the adoption of Ripple solutions such as On-Demand Liquidity (ODL) and partnerships with institutions like Santander and Bank of America may support price increases.

◦ Competition: Stablecoins (like USDT and USDC) and central bank digital currencies (CBDCs) may reduce the demand for XRP in cross-border payments.

4 Technical Analysis Signals:

◦ Support and Resistance Levels: Support at $2.00-$2.20, and resistance at $2.85-$3.00. Breaking any of these levels could lead to strong volatility.

◦ Indicators: Moving averages, the Relative Strength Index (RSI), and MACD are commonly used to forecast trends. The current trend is generally bullish, but the 'double top' pattern may indicate a short-term bearish correction.
